A Milford man has been arrested for allegedly stealing nearly two dozen guns in a pair of burglaries at a Bangor pawn shop.

Travis Stinson, 39, was arrested without incident in Bangor on Friday, the Bangor Police Department said in a news release on Monday.

He's accused in burglaries at J.G. Pawn Shop on Center Street.

In the first burglary, Sept. 30, five handguns were taken from the pawn shop. Sixteen firearms were stolen from the business on Oct. 12.

Police said Stinson is also a suspect in another recent commercial burglary in the city, which is currently under investigation.
